Sarawak cops bid farewell to comrade who drowned in boating accident

Sgt Jonathan Lambet among five who drowned after their boat was caught in whirlpool in Sg Baleh.

WITH heavy hearts, policemen in Kapit, Sarawak bid farewell to their comrade, Sgt Jonathan Lambet, who tragically drowned in a boating accident last Thursday.

Reports in Borneo Post said eight pallbearers carried Lambet’s coffin during the ceremony at the Kapit district police headquarters.

The ceremony was attended by police officers, personnel and also civilians.

Among those who paid their last respects were Kapit police chief Rohana Nanu, Song police chief Rowney Michael Jalat, and Dalat police chief Saga Chunggat.

The cortege left the police headquarters about 9.15am for Lambet’s final journey home to Bau, where his funeral will be held tomorrow.

Lambet was among five people who drowned when the boat they were in sank after it was caught in a whirlpool near SK Lepong Baleh in Sg Baleh about 5pm last Thursday.

Only one person, Moses Ngui, survived after he was saved by a passing longboat driver and passenger.

Lambet’s body was found last Saturday at the Kapit Waterfront.

The body of the boat driver, Jack Balan, was found in Sibu, while passenger Amerson John Nain’s body was discovered in Meradong.

Search and rescue efforts for Cpl Iskandar Ibrahim from Kelantan had since entered its sixth day. – The Vibes, March 12, 2024
